You
may wonder what my classes offer that will be different than
standard childbirth classes offered through the hospital.Since
the classes are independent, I can offer a broad spectrum
of information about choices that are available to birthing
women. My classes are offered in 3 modules, offering 25 hours
of instruction time, which is twice as long as most hospital
classes. The first module is a 2 session "Nutrition/Exercise/
Relaxation" class that can be taken at any point in pregnancy.
The second module is the 6 week "Birth" class that
will cover informed decision making and comfort techniques
for labor. The final module is a two session class on breastfeeding
and newborn care.
We
cover topics more in depth than is done in the standard classes,
providing expectant parents with information about the pros
and cons of various medications and procedures so that they
can make informed decisions.

The
extended length of the classes also allow for more time to practice
labor techniques-parents taking standard classes often forget
many of the techniques they learned to handle labor once they
are in the midst of labor; but parents taking longer classes
usually report feeling much more confident and able to recall
what to do to cope. My "Birth" module is limited to
4-8 couples, in contrast to hospital classes where 10-14 couples
is not unusual. The class size allows for more individual attention
in answering questions, as well as in scheduling classes to
meet the needs of the couples involved.
